How To Play - Camel Up Board Game
Camel Up Rules & Gameplay
Place the board on the table, load the five colored dice into the pyramid shaker, and give each player their betting cards, spectator tile, and starting coins. Place all five camels at the starting line.
On your turn choose exactly one of four actions: bet on the current leg leader, bet on the overall race winner or loser, place your spectator tile on the track, or take a pyramid ticket to move a camel.
Take the top betting tile of any camel you think will lead at the end of this leg. The earlier you bet on the right camel, the higher your payout. Wrong bets lose you one coin.
Place your spectator tile to nudge camels forward or backward when they land on it. Take a pyramid ticket to release one die and move that camel. Stacked camels always move together as one group.
A leg ends when all five dice have been rolled. Players score their leg betting tiles based on the current race leader. Tiles are returned, dice go back into the pyramid, and a new leg begins.
The game ends when any camel crosses the finish line. Final leg scoring happens, then race betting cards are revealed. Correct overall winner predictions earn up to 8 coins. The player with the most Egyptian Pounds wins.
Pros & Cons - Camel Up Board Game
What’s Great
- Hilarious and unpredictable, no two games ever play out the same
- Easy to learn, rules explained in about 10 minutes
- Supports up to 8 players, perfect for large groups
- Camel stacking mechanic creates wild and unexpected race changes
- Great for families, casual players, and non-gamers
- Won Game of the Year (Spiel des Jahres) in 2014
- Fast-paced with turns that take only seconds
What’s Not
- Heavy on luck, strategy alone cannot guarantee a win
- Less exciting with only 3 players, better with 5 or more
- Players who dislike randomness may find outcomes frustrating
- Not suitable for those looking for deep strategic gameplay
Camel Up Board Game Details
| Publisher | Eggertspiele / PD Publishing |
| Year Released | 2014 (Second Edition 2018) |
| Players | 3 to 8 Players |
| Play Time | 30 to 45 Minutes |
| Recommended Age | 8 and up |
| Complexity | Moderate |
| Category | Family Game, Betting, Racing |
| Awards | Spiel des Jahres 2014 (Game of the Year) |
